13 September 2019 - Nashville, Tenn - Today is the day! Black River Christian artist and songwriter Hannah Kerr releases her new EP,  Listen More , digitally everywhere . Last night,  Kerr joined Jordan Feliz in Cleburne, TX for the kick-off of his The Faith Tour, where she is selling exclusive physical copies of Listen More.
 
The six tracks featured on Listen More are all co-written by Kerr and produced by Mark Miller, who also produced her debut album Overflow, and Riley Friesen  (Jen Ledger, FamilyForce5, Building 429) .  She wrote this album with a  new confidence, due to many challenges she has faced over the last few years. Listen More  came from a reflective place, w hile Overflow, which she recorded when she was just 19 years old, came from a place of letting God pour into her and her heart overflowing in worship, thus beginning her ministry in music. 
 
“This really is a ministry,” she shares. “I’m not trying to just throw music at people and hope it sticks. I really want the songs to be something that sparks conversation and will let people know that I’m willing to talk about the things that I’ve been through, and I want to hear what they’ve been through.”
Listen More  reintroduces Hannah Kerr as an artist who has grown and who is rooted more deeply into her sound, voice, and purpose. Beginning this new life chapter, she is allowing listeners to join her on the journey where she is “figuring out who God is, and in the process, really figuring out who I am."

Kerr is sharing many of her new songs live on Feliz's " The Faith Tour"  along with special guests I AM THEY and North Point Insideout. The tour began this week and will venture throughout the U.S., wrapping in Nashville, TN at the end of November.
 
She will then embark on the "2019 K-LOVE Christmas Tour" this holiday season along with Matthew West, Matt Maher, and I AM THEY. The tour will hit twelve markets throughout December. ABOUT HANNAH KERR: Touted as a “compelling” and “encouraging” artist by CCM Magazine, Black River Christian artist/songwriter Hannah Kerr's new EP Listen More is available now. The six-song project, all co-written by Kerr, features the Top 20 radio hit  “Split the Sea,” which has more than four million streams, earning Kerr more than 45 million total streams. Partnering with award-winning composer David Hamilton (Andrea Bocelli, Josh Groban), Kerr debuted a new arrangement and music video this summer for "Split The Sea." 
 
Kerr is currently on the road sharing new music as support for Jordan Feliz’s "The Faith Tour," which runs through November. She will then join the "2019 K-LOVE Christmas Tour" this December, performing music from her full-length holiday album, Christmas Eve In Bethlehem
 
Kerr was awarded the Most Played Song  award at the 2018 ASCAP Christian Awards for co-writing Matt Maher’s Top 5 hit “Your Love Defends Me.” Her original version of the song appears on her debut album Overflow which has earned more than 20 million streams and features the Top 15 hit “Warrior.” She has shared the stage with major Christian artists including Casting Crowns, Matt Maher, Building 429, Jonny Diaz, Matt Hammitt, as well as for KING & COUNTRY, Newsboys, and Kari Jobe. 
 
Kerr recently graduated from Belmont University with her degree in Christian Leadership.
